Multipump Pro Centralised High-pressure Washer
The Multipump Pro is a centralised system incorporating 2, 3, 4, 5, or 6 modular pumps. The standard unit is available in a 3 pump system and can be added to without changing the control system. The IP65 rated control panel monitors the entire system to prevent leaks, over pressure, over temperature or shortages of water.
How the system works
Basically the modular unit is housed in a plant room or maintenance section of a factory. Outlets from the system are then piped round the factory and plug in points are then installed at each required position. Any number of outlets can be fitted though the number of outlets used at any one time is dependant on the number of pumps. Therefore a 3 pump system means 3 operators can work simultaneously.
Operation and Features
The modular control system detects a drop in pressure, and starts one of the pumps on demand. The pumps are synchronised to prevent excessive wear and tear to the first pump. As each operator connects to the plug in point, and demands more water, the system starts a 2nd and then a 3rd pump until the correct flow is achieved. When operators stop using a plug in point, the same happens in reverse. The system is designed to provide simultaneous washing throughout a factory, for between 3 and 6 operators. A 3 pump system can be added to, up to 6 modules in total, without the need to replace the control panel.
| Model | Multipump Pro Centralized Static HPW | ![]() |
|---|---|---|
| Product No. | 12.000.2700 | |
| Voltage | 415 V | |
| Wattage | 12000W | |
| Pressure | 20-200 bar (adjustable) | |
| Flow Rate | 2700 l/h | |
| Pump Type | Linear | |
| Max Water Inlet Temp | 75oC |
Please Note: The featured machine above is a 3 pump system. The system is available with up to 6 pumps.
